Description: The GTK+ graphical user interface library - DirectFB runtime
|
|
The GTK+ is a multi-platform toolkit for creating graphical user
|
|
interfaces. Offering a complete set of widgets, the GTK+ is suitable
|
|
for projects ranging from small one-off tools to complete application
|
|
suites.
|
|
.
|
|
This version uses DirectFB, a thin library providing an integrated
|
|
windowing system and hardware acceleration on top of the Linux
|
|
framebuffer.
